THE CIAA TOURNAMENT IS HERE!
Starting today and running through March 3

(BALTIMORE – February 26, 2024) – The Central Intercollegiate Athletic Association (CIAA), the nation’s oldest Historically Black Athletic Conference, announces the brackets for its 2024 Women’s and Men’s Basketball Tournament. The single-elimination tournament will be held in CFG Bank Arena in Baltimore, MD on February 26 – March 2nd. Championship games will tip-off at 7:00 p.m. for the women followed by the men at 9:00 p.m. on Monday, February 26th. Each bracket is seeded based on Division record. If division records are tied, the first tiebreaker is head-to-head results followed by point differential.

In the Men’s field, Lincoln University (PA) solidified the top seed in the Northern Division squeaking out a +5 point differential tiebreaker against Virginia Union. Led by Head Coach Jason Armstrong, the Lions finished the regular season with a 12-4 record in CIAA action. After falling short in last year’s tournament championship, the Lions will be looking for redemption in Baltimore. The No. 2 seed goes to Virginia Union. Under the guidance of head coach Jay Butler, the Panthers finished regular season play with an 8-9 conference record closing out with a big win against Virginia State. With a 3-way tie for the No. 3 seed, the Trojans of Virginia State secured their spot with two regular season wins against Bowie State and a +4 point differential against Elizabeth City State. With the Trojans at the No. 3 seed, Bowie State edges out Elizabeth City State with two head-to-head regular season wins and take the No.4 seed.
